WebMay 6, 2016 · You may be fired for your drunk driving charge Depending on your job and the contract you signed to take the position, a DUI conviction could result in you losing your employment permanently. Some employers have a policy that allows for dismissal if you’re convicted of a crime, and DUI is a crime. Simply … fnaf spriters resourceWebOct 29, 2013 · If your job does not involve driving and your DUI was not during work hours, you may be eligible for unemployment benefits. The California Employment Development Department (EDD) administers California’s unemployment insurance program and evaluates claims for benefits.
